What it does

TPM is a hardware or firmware-backed trust anchor. Windows uses it for things like measured boot, stronger sign-in protections, and drive-encryption workflows. It does not clean malware by itself. It mainly gives the system a safer place to anchor secrets and trust decisions.

You normally review understand what tpm is used for in modern windows security when you want to understand what Windows is doing, what changes it can influence, and whether it is relevant before you touch settings blindly. Useful things to notice first: check TPM readiness before turning on stronger features; keep firmware updated from trusted sources; save recovery information for encryption changes; treat TPM as one layer, not the whole security story.
